I have the PC along with a Hemifever 89 tune on my Trinity. I like being able to adjust the throttle response on the fly as opposed to having to reflash the tune. It works out great for me because if I want to have some fun I put the PC in Sport +4 and then turn it off for normal driving. I also put it in Eco when I'm towing so that I get about the stock throttle feel when I tow my camper.

Sport+ +4 and a Hemifever tune is absolutely insane. Chirp the tires at will.

We always have customers asking about is a PC usable with a tune. My response is they compliment each other. the tuner gives more power and the PC gives more throttle control and that control is also on the fly unlike most tuners. the PC has 36 settings from tame to crazy.

Whats the deal with this? I just did dome light reading about it and watched some videos. Is it real or placebo? Any here run in yet?

Definitely real! It’s not like a tuner it’s designed to remove the lag between foot and car. When the car can react as fast as the foot then that’s an improvement.
It was the very first mod I bought after buying my truck and couldn’t be happier.

The Pedal Commander does not directly "talk" to the transmission but the changes it makes to the throttle changes how the transmission performs. It definitely will get it to down shift sooner instead of lug along like it would stock.

Well worth the money. Does not increase hp or tq however it takes away any "lag" you might experience during acceleration. Lots of people here have them and they seem to get good reviews. As was stated check out the threads about them.
